The current laws of the state of New York say that his information is available by request. The state law of New York says the clerk must provide it. The first amendment states that no laws can be passed abridging the freedom of the press.
As a gun owner, I'd never want my name published. As a newspaper man, I never want the press silenced. As a law abiding citizen, I want our laws complied with. If we don't like a law, we need to work to change it not refuse to comply with them.

Bell30012, >>Unfortunately, this clerk is violating the law. The way the current law of New York is written, he is in clear violation. There is no shot in court of it holding up. In the end it will cost this county and maybe this individual a lot of money. The newspaper will get the information in the end.<< *** It may not be as cut and dry as you think. Aren't gun owners, and everyone else for that matter, entitled to their own privacy? To be secure in their persons, houses, papers, and effects as stated in the Fourth Amendment? Isn't forcing a local government to provide an organization with the names, addresses, maps on how to get to their homes and even pictures of their property INFRINGING UPON THEIR RIGHT TO KEEP AND BEAR ARMS? Isn't the rights of neighboring gun owners also being violated as they now become easy marks for criminals?
